गृहपृष्ठ ∕ Nepal ∕ Earthquake recorded in Dhankuta Nepal Earthquake recorded in Dhankuta KathmanduPati November 28, 2022 File Photo KATHMANDU – An earthquake was recorded with its epicenter at Mulghat of Dhankuta this morning. According to the National Earthquake Monitoring and Research Centre, the earthquake measuring 4.0 in the Richter scale was recorded at 10:45 am. Earlier on Saturday, an earthquake measuring 3.0 in the Richter scale was recorded with its epicenter at Bilyante bazaar of Ilam.
